Monthly Cost of Living

Monthly costs for one person with rent: $1,836 in Kristianstad versus $1,218 in Tbilisi.

Estimated couple costs with rent: $2,794 in Kristianstad versus $1,853 in Tbilisi.

Monthly costs for a family of three with rent: $3,752 in Kristianstad versus $2,489 in Tbilisi.

Living in Kristianstad is roughly 51% more expensive than Tbilisi, driven mainly by Groceries & Markets.

The two cities straddle the global median: Kristianstad is 37% above, Tbilisi is 9% below.

Cost Breakdown

A one-bedroom apartment in the center runs $807 in Kristianstad and $692 in Tbilisi. Housing cost is often the main lever when comparing two cities.

Kristianstad pays 317% more on average. The extra income cushions the higher costs, though housing choices and lifestyle decide how much of the gap is truly closed.

Dining out: $73.0 in Kristianstad vs $44.00 in Tbilisi for a mid-range dinner for two. Groceries echo the gap at $366 vs $204 per month, with Tbilisi cheaper across the board.
